#29b320 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#29b320 is composed of 16.1% red, 70.2% green and 12.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 77.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 82.1% yellow and 29.8% black. It has a hue angle of 116.3 degrees, a saturation of 69.7% and a lightness of 41.4%. #29b320 color hex could be obtained by blending #52ff40 with #006700.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

#29b320 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#29b320 has RGB values of R:41, G:179, B:32 and CMYK values of C:0.77, M:0, Y:0.82,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 2732832.

Shades and Tints of #29b320
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030d02 is the darkest color, while #fbfefb is the lightest one.

Tones of #29b320
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#696a69 is the less saturated color, while #14cb08 is the most saturated one.
